Burnham-On-Sea fire crew tackle blaze at Highbridge company

Burnham-On-Sea firefighters were still at the scene of a fire in a Highbridge storage silo on Thursday morning (April 24th).

Fire crews were called on Wednesday afternoon to Woodberry Bros and Haines after smoke was seen emerging from the tall structure, leading to the evacuation of some staff.

Fire vehicles from Burnham, Bridgwater, Yeovil, Weston and Street were sent to the scene at 2.47pm.

Our photos show the crews tackling the fire in the sawdust storage silo, which was approximately 60 feet high.

"The cause of this fire was a dust explosion within the silo," explained a fire spokesman.

"There was 60 per cent fire, smoke, heat and water damage to sawdust in the silo plus 40 per cent fire and heat damage to the silo itself."

Two fire engines from Burnham-On-Sea were still at the scene on Thursday morning (April 23rd) as the fire continued.
